Quality Compliance Manager

We are currently partnering with a successful and growing international food manufacturing business to recruit a Quality Compliance Manager. This is a fantastic opportunity for an experienced quality professional to take ownership of compliance, food safety, and quality systems while leading and developing a high-performing QC team.

Reporting directly to the Technical Manager, you will take ownership of quality systems, lead a small team, and champion a positive food safety culture throughout the operation.

Quality Compliance Manager

Key Responsibilities

Lead and manage all quality compliance and food safety activities across site
Develop and mentor a QC team of 6, driving performance and engagement
Manage internal audits, GMP audits, and hygiene audits
Oversee QHSE systems, action logs, and compliance deadlines
Handle customer complaints, including root cause analysis and CAPA
Manage non-conformance processes and ensure timely close-out
Monitor microbiological trends and implement preventative actions
Ensure pest control and calibration processes meet required standards
Coordinate New Product Introduction (NPI) ensuring compliance
Maintain and improve quality documentation and systems
Drive a strong food safety culture across the site

Quality Compliance Manager Skills

Proven experience in food manufacturing quality management
Strong knowledge of BRC / BRCGS, HACCP, GMP, QHSE

Experience with internal audits and compliance systems
Skilled in root cause analysis, CAPA, and non-conformance management
Strong leadership experience - team management & coaching
Excellent problem-solving and analytical skills
Confident communicator with strong stakeholder management ability
Hands-on approach with a continuous improvement mindset
